race weight was about 3810 by my best guess and boost around 20psi
I weighed my car previously at a strip at 3600. That was with my Racing Hart wheels (46lb tire/wheel). The RS4 Reps are 52lb tire/wheel, thus an extra 24lbs. Add in my 185 and we're up to ~3810 assuming nothing else changed much (gas was about the same - I changed suspsension but should be very similar - I did go back to stock brakes, not sure how much that changed)
When I go out next, I'll be without seats and with my OZ wheels.
It kinda sucks that I need to remove my seats just to get to an even weight of a Sedan, but day-to-day I'd never trade away my Avant just for that weight difference )

I was really just messing with you BUT I ran 13.00 @ 110mph with a 1.9 60' time I believe... all on street tires.
If I had slicks I think I could have easily ran in the mid to high 12's.
Hooking up in 1st and 2nd was a bitch due to so much tire spin.

Stay away from the APR kit.
I got rid of mine after the endless battles with APR and the bull**** I had to go through with the bolts backing out of the housing. And I think that there are other companies out there now making more power for less money. My GTI never made the power that other stage3 kits were making. I was always down by 15-20whp... ALWAYS!
